FAA’s Oversight Failures Contributed to Alaska Airlines Door Plug Mishap

The National Transportation Safety Board (NTSB) has issued its final report about the Alaska Airlines mid-air door plug blowout on a Boeing 737 MAX 9, which happened in January 2024. The investigators concluded that the probable cause was Boeing’s failure to provide adequate training, guidance, and oversight to ensure proper manufacturing process, including the removal of the mid-exit door (MED) plug.
